Where the team fits in

This role sits within PropTrack. PropTrack provides property data and technical platform solutions to customers in the financial and government sectors. The Engineering Team within PropTrack works together to deliver solutions to our internal and external customers. It is the core delivery centre for developing solutions to meet customer priorities and align with PropTrack's technology strategy.

Within PropTrack, this Senior Data Engineer role is part of the Core Property Data (CPD) team. CPD is responsible for building and operating property-centric data platforms and APIs that power a wide range of internal products and external data solutions across REA and PropTrack, with a particular focus on Prime, our next-generation property data platform.

What the role is all about

  • Designing, building and maintaining data pipelines, models and APIs across ingestion, transformation and consumption layers.
  • Contribute to and lead technical design and architecture discussions, helping shape how our data, property datasets and APIs evolve to support current and future use cases.
  • Working with technologies such as Airflow/Breeze, BigQuery, Kafka and modern backend languages (e.g. TypeScript/Node, Python) to deliver accurate, timely and reliable property data.
  • Enhancing existing products, including resolving data quality issues, improving performance and implementing scalable patterns.
  • Supporting production systems by contributing to monitoring, observability, automation and operational best practices.
  • Ensuring the reliability, security and resilience of our systems in line with REA’s “you build it, you run it” philosophy.
  • Collaborating with engineers, analysts and product managers to understand requirements and design high-quality, user-centred solutions.
  • Provide technical guidance and mentoring to other engineers in your squad, lifting engineering practices and supporting less experienced team members.

Who we’re looking for

  • Strong API experience required in owning, building and integrating APIs
  • 5+ years of hands on experience in the industry, working in some or all of data engineering, full stack software engineering and platform engineering, with a focus on data intensive systems at scale.
  • Strong programming skills in at least one modern language (e.g. TypeScript/Node.js, Python), plus strong SQL capability for analytical and production workloads.
  • Proven experience building and maintaining data pipelines and data models using tools such as Airflow/Breeze and BigQuery, or equivalent orchestration and warehouse technologies.
  • Solid understanding of data modelling, data quality and data governance practices, and how to apply them in large scale property or transactional data environments.
  • Experience working with cloud platforms (GCP and/or AWS) and DevOps concepts such as Docker, CI/CD and infrastructure as code (e.g. Terraform, CDK, CloudFormation).
  • Demonstrated ability to diagnose and resolve data quality issues, performance problems and production incidents in distributed data systems.
  • Ability to communicate and collaborate effectively with engineers, analysts, product managers and other stakeholders as required.
  • A curious, pragmatic mindset with a passion for building reliable, scalable data solutions that deliver real value for customers and internal teams.
